Ticket: ParityScope checker flags false mismatches

Rate-parity checker in ParityScope compares cached rates against live feeds without normalizing currency rounding. Result: ~3% false mismatch alerts for the Harbrook pilot hotels. No data exposure; comparison happens server-side only. Fix: round both sides before diff. Repro confirmed on the build identified below.

trace token, tawep-fahif: htk3_b58

Hey — handing off the Wrenbolt circuit breaker work. The breaker in front of the Tallowgrove upstream API trips at 30% failure over 60s and half-opens after two minutes. It's been flappy since Tuesday, so watch the metrics. If you need to manually reset the breaker from the ops shell, it'll prompt you, and the recovery passphrase you'll enter is below.

strongbox words: norwyn-wenael-aldvan-aldiel-wendor-holael

# Bannerbee Environments

Quick notes for reviewers: the consent banner rollout runs in three environments — sandbox, staging, and prod. Sandbox auto-resets nightly, staging mirrors prod traffic at 5%, and prod is behind the Oakfern feature flag. Don't merge without checking staging first. The staging environment currently runs with these settings.

settings of tawef-hawip:
ralwyn:
  pin: 4951
  metrics_host: metrics.ralwyn.lumiclabs.internal
  tenant: holius
  seal: seal_a64c8eee

Branch managers: this summary covers the planned shift of Pellarin Services subscriptions from monthly to annual billing. Modelling shows improved cash predictability and lower collection costs, offset by a one-time deferred-revenue bulge in the transition quarter. Discounting for annual prepay will be capped at ten percent, and branch incentive targets will be restated to match the new recognition schedule. Please validate your local renewal calendars before rollout. The underlying strategic reasoning is set out in the note below.

internal memo for kawip-hadug: Headcount on the Wenwyn team goes from 7 to 140 by the end of January. Gross margin on Wenwyn came in at 20 percent against a plan of 15 percent.